Trying Differently Rather Than Harder: Fetal Alcohol Spectrum Disorders

Description

Have you ever felt like you’ve tried everything to change behaviors and nothing worked? The harder you tried, the more discouraged, alone, and desperate you felt? There is hope!

The FASCETS Neurobehavioral Approach links brain with behaviors, leading to supports that actually make a difference. We pause and ask, “What if the brain has something to do with what I’m seeing?” This allows us to respond to confusing, sometimes challenging, behaviors in new ways. It strengthens relationships and wellbeing. Let’s think brain first!

This new, updated and expanded version of Diane Malbin’s original work invites the reader to explore and respond to neurodiversity from a new perspective. It includes an introduction to Primary Characteristics commonly associated with neurodiversity and explores the challenges that result from a poor fit between how an individual’s brain works and their environment, including an extensive collection of stories showing the power of implementing the NB Approach. It offers a pathway to hope, greater peace and connection. It also specifically addresses fetal alcohol spectrum disorder (FASD), affecting at least one in twenty people in North America.
